Looking for a bitterfest?
Jay Nordlinger isn't taking the high road on the Obama win, but he does see a not-entirely-dim side:
There may be some positive outcomes to Obama’s election victory. It could be, now, that the Left will help us in the War on Terror. Some people said, for years, that they would never be onboard until they were in charge. Until now, they have done everything possible to thwart Bush. The New York Times delights in exposing clandestine programs, designed to keep the innocent safe. Will all that end now?Also, maybe the Left will feel better about the country itself. Some of my neighbors (Manhattan) have gloated with me about November 4. And I’ve said, “Yes, America is a good country, isn’t it? Good constitution, good system, don’t you agree?” That leaves them a little nonplussed or annoyed.
And then there is race — about which I have written as much as I have any subject in my journalism career. (For a biggish piece on race and the ’08 election, go here.) I don’t believe that a presidential election was necessary to validate racial progress. But other people do. And it will be an even better day when skin is not an issue: when what matters is what a person thinks, and what a person is.
Besides which, if Obama fails, making bad or even disastrous decisions, will that reflect badly on black Americans as a whole? Of course not: It will reflect badly on Obama, and possibly Joe Biden, and others. (Incidentally, Biden was wrong on everything having to do with the Cold War. He fought everything that worked, tooth and nail. Will lights finally go off in his brain now?)
